当前位置: 首页>>代码示例 >>用法及示例精选 >>正文


JavaScript String repeat()用法及代码示例


repeat()方法在 JavaScript 中通过将原始字符串连接指定次数来返回一个新字符串。

用法:

string.repeat(count);

参数:

此方法接受单个参数。

  • count:count 是一个整数值,显示重复给定字符串的次数。整数 “count” 的范围是从零 (0) 到无穷大。

返回值:

它返回一个新字符串,其中包含指定数量的字符串副本。

JavaScript 字符串 repeat() 方法示例

示例 1:使用 repeat() 重复字符串两次

该代码使用repeat()方法重复字符串“forGeeks”两次,创建一个新字符串“forGeeksforGeeks”。此方法返回一个新字符串,其中原始字符串重复指定的次数。

let str = "forGeeks";
let repeatCount = str.repeat(2);
console.log(repeatCount);

输出
forGeeksforGeeks

示例 2:使用 repeat() 重复字符串五次

该代码使用 repeat() 方法将字符串 “gfg” 重复五次,从而生成字符串 “gfggfggfggfggfg”。此方法返回一个新字符串,其中原始字符串重复指定的次数。

// Taking a string "gfg"
let str = "gfg";

// Repeating the string multiple times
let repeatCount = str.repeat(5);
console.log(repeatCount);

输出
gfggfggfggfggfg

示例 3:使用 repeat() 重复字符串两次

该代码使用 repeat() 方法重复字符串 “gfg” 两次。即使重复计数为 2.9,它也会转换为 2,从而导致输出为 “gfggfg”。

// Taking a string "gfg"
let str = "gfg";

// Repeating the string 2.9 times i.e, 2 times
// because 2.9 converted into 2
let repeatCount = str.repeat(2.9);
console.log(repeatCount);

输出
gfggfg

我们有 Javascript 字符串方法的完整列表,要检查这些方法,请浏览此Javascript 字符串完整参考文章。

支持的浏览器:


相关用法


注:本文由纯净天空筛选整理自Kanchan_Ray大神的英文原创作品 JavaScript String repeat() Method。非经特殊声明,原始代码版权归原作者所有,本译文未经允许或授权,请勿转载或复制。